Why Built-In Bookcases Work So Well in Cottages
Dorset’s traditional cottages weren’t designed with modern storage needs in mind. Thick stone walls, low ceilings, and uneven floors can make flat-pack or freestanding furniture a poor fit.
Benefits of built-in bookcases for smaller homes:
-
Tailored to fit alcoves and sloped ceilings
-
Maximise vertical space without overwhelming the room
-
Avoid wasted space behind or beside furniture
-
Can double as display shelving or hide away clutter
-
Built to complement the existing period features
Making the Most of Limited Space
In smaller rooms, smart joinery design makes all the difference. A well-placed bookcase can offer far more than just shelf space—it can create a visual focal point, help zone a room, or even act as a subtle divider in open-plan living areas.
Popular cottage-friendly bookcase styles:
-
Chimney breast alcove shelving - Perfect for living rooms in period homes
-
Under-stair bookcases - Utilise that awkward space with clean, functional storage
-
Floor-to-ceiling units - Maximise wall height without encroaching on floor space
-
Built-in seating with storage and shelves - Great for bay windows or reading nooks
